METRO desde Recursos?

Post Reply
User avatar
Blessed
Posts: 243
Joined: Wed Sep 19, 2007 4:32 pm
Location: Honduras, C.A.
Contact:

METRO desde Recursos?

Post by Blessed »

Antonio
Tengo muchos dialogos de proyectos en archos RC ya realizados, y quiero pasarlos, al estilo METRO.
Ademas de reescribir todo a @SAY, habra alguna manera de hacerlo.
Inclusive Usar METROBUTTON desde recursos.
En alguna futura version no tan lejana quizas?

Saludos
Last edited by Blessed on Wed Nov 20, 2013 12:05 am, edited 1 time in total.
_ A. Martinez
http://www.multisofthn.com
Honduras, Centro America
xHarbour Enterprise 1.2.2, Fivewin 13.06
User avatar
Antonio Linares
Site Admin
Posts: 37481
Joined: Thu Oct 06, 2005 5:47 pm
Location: Spain
Contact:

Re: METRO desde Recusos?

Post by Antonio Linares »

_,

Es que la distribución de los controles con el estilo Metro es muy diferente a la distribución clásica, asi que me temo que hacerlo de forma automática no es fácil
regards, saludos

Antonio Linares
www.fivetechsoft.com
hmpaquito
Posts: 1200
Joined: Thu Oct 30, 2008 2:37 pm

Re: METRO desde Recusos?

Post by hmpaquito »

Antonio,

Si antes ya podia ser recomendable, ahora, en metro, quiza sea necesario, al menos en caso de scrolling, el diseño de pantallas 'RELATIVO'
Ejem:

#Define PIX_SEP_HORIZONTAL 20
#Define PIX_SEP_SAY_GET 5
nY:= 10
@ nY, 10 SAY "esto es un say" VAR oSay
@ nY, 10+ oDlg:GetWidth(oSay:cCaption)+ PIX_SEP_SAY_GET GET oGet

nY+= PIX_SEP_HORIZONTAL
.......................................

Y asi con todos los controles de un dialogo. Habria que ver como tratar los group

Un saludo
User avatar
Antonio Linares
Site Admin
Posts: 37481
Joined: Thu Oct 06, 2005 5:47 pm
Location: Spain
Contact:

Re: METRO desde Recusos?

Post by Antonio Linares »

Posiblemente Otto que es de quienes han trabajado mas en estos diseños nos podria comentar su experiencia.

Probably Otto, who has worked very much on Metro design could comment us his experience
regards, saludos

Antonio Linares
www.fivetechsoft.com
User avatar
Blessed
Posts: 243
Joined: Wed Sep 19, 2007 4:32 pm
Location: Honduras, C.A.
Contact:

Re: METRO desde Recursos?

Post by Blessed »

Antonio
Me conformaria con simular el BTNBMP como el METROBUTTON (visualizacion), de momento.
Y como quitar el Borde 3D a un dialogo para pasarlo, para llamarlo desde el panel.

Saludos
_ A. Martinez
http://www.multisofthn.com
Honduras, Centro America
xHarbour Enterprise 1.2.2, Fivewin 13.06
User avatar
cnavarro
Posts: 5792
Joined: Wed Feb 15, 2012 8:25 pm
Location: España

Re: METRO desde Recursos?

Post by cnavarro »

_
En cuanto al dialogo, prueba poniendo este estilo

Code: Select all

STYLE nOr( WS_CHILD, WS_POPUP ) ;
 
C. Navarro
Hay dos tipos de personas: las que te hacen perder el tiempo y las que te hacen perder la noción del tiempo
Si alguien te dice que algo no se puede hacer, recuerda que esta hablando de sus limitaciones, no de las tuyas.
User avatar
Blessed
Posts: 243
Joined: Wed Sep 19, 2007 4:32 pm
Location: Honduras, C.A.
Contact:

Re: METRO desde Recursos?

Post by Blessed »

Cristobal
Gracias por responder, ese es el estilo que se usa desde codigo, pero no funciona para recursos.
Estoy usando Pelles C, como editor de recursos, y solo me ofrece o POPUP o CHILD (ademas de Overlapped) no ambas

Saludos
_ A. Martinez
http://www.multisofthn.com
Honduras, Centro America
xHarbour Enterprise 1.2.2, Fivewin 13.06
User avatar
cnavarro
Posts: 5792
Joined: Wed Feb 15, 2012 8:25 pm
Location: España

Re: METRO desde Recursos?

Post by cnavarro »

Has comprobado THICKFRAME ?
Image
C. Navarro
Hay dos tipos de personas: las que te hacen perder el tiempo y las que te hacen perder la noción del tiempo
Si alguien te dice que algo no se puede hacer, recuerda que esta hablando de sus limitaciones, no de las tuyas.
El Loco
Posts: 220
Joined: Fri May 19, 2006 4:08 pm

Re: METRO desde Recursos?

Post by El Loco »

Blessed wrote:Antonio
Me conformaria con simular el BTNBMP como el METROBUTTON (visualizacion), de momento.
Y como quitar el Borde 3D a un dialogo para pasarlo, para llamarlo desde el panel.

Saludos
Creo que con la clase BtnFlat, la parte de botones estaría solucionado, solo falta poder usarla desde recursos.
La parte de diálogos con redefinir al mismo como Style nOr( WS_POPUP, WS_BORDER ) creo que bastaría.
Abrazos.
Miguel
User avatar
Blessed
Posts: 243
Joined: Wed Sep 19, 2007 4:32 pm
Location: Honduras, C.A.
Contact:

Re: METRO desde Recursos?

Post by Blessed »

Saludos

Con maximizar el dialogo le ha perecido bien a mi cliente.
Pero, no se si Antonio tendra en planes para hacer uso de la clase btnFlat desde recursos; como dice miguel eso seria grandioso.
_ A. Martinez
http://www.multisofthn.com
Honduras, Centro America
xHarbour Enterprise 1.2.2, Fivewin 13.06
Post Reply